Located in the Clayton County School District at 160 Roberts Dr in Riverdale, GA, Riverdale High School serves grades 9-12 and has an enrollment of roughly 1237 students. Frequently Asked Questions about Riverdale
How much are Studio apartments in Riverdale?
There are currently 18 Studio Apartments in Riverdale with rent ranges from $935 to $1,650 with an average price of $1,191.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Riverdale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Riverdale ranges from $775 to $2,499 with an average monthly rent of $1,183.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Riverdale c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Riverdale range from $784 to $3,362.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,342.
How expensive are Riverdale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 78 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Riverdale on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$889 to $4,436 - averaging $1,773 for the location.
